### 🔑 SSH Key Format
When loading SSH keys, you can specify the format using the `ssh-format` query parameter. This is useful when you need the private key in a specific format like OpenSSH.
```yml
- name: Load SSH key
uses: 1password/load-secrets-action@v3
env:
OP_SERVICE_ACCOUNT_TOKEN: ${{ secrets.OP_SERVICE_ACCOUNT_TOKEN }}
# Load SSH private key in OpenSSH format
SSH_PRIVATE_KEY: op://vault/item/private key?ssh-format=openssh
```
For more details on secret reference syntax, see the [1Password CLI documentation](https://developer.1password.com/docs/cli/secret-reference-syntax/#ssh-format-parameter).

# Fork PR Testing Guide
This document explains how testing works for external pull requests from forks.
## Overview
The testing system consists of two main workflows:
1. **E2E Tests** (`test-e2e.yml`) - Runs automatically for internal PRs, need manual trigger on external PRs.
2. **Ok To Test** (`ok-to-test.yml`) - Dispatches `repository_dispatch` event when maintainer puts the `/ok-to-test sha=<commit hash>` comment in the forked PR thread.
## How It Works
### 1. PR is created by maintainer:
For the PR created by maintainer `E2E Test` workflow starts automatically. The PR check will reflect the status of the job.
### 2. PR is created by external contributor:
For the PR created by external contributor `E2E Test` workflow **won't** start automatically.
Maintainer should make a sanity check of the changes and run it manually by:
1. Putting a comment `/ok-to-test sha=<latest commit hash>` in the PR thread.
2. `E2E Test` workflow starts.
3. After `E2E Test` workflow finishes, a comment with a link to the workflow, along with its status will be posted in the PR.
4. Maintainer can merge PR or request the changes based on the `E2E Test` results.
## Notes
- Only users with **write** permissions can trigger the `/ok-to-test` command.
- External PRs are automatically detected and prevented from running e2e tests automatically.
- Running e2e test on the external PR is optional. Maintainer can merge PR without running it. Maintainer decides whether it's needed to run an E2E test.

# Local Testing Guide
This document explains how to run e2e tests locally using `act`.
## Prerequisites
1. **Docker** installed and running
2. **act** installed ([install guide](https://github.com/nektos/act#installation))
```bash
brew install act # macOS
```
3. **1Password credentials** (see [Required Secrets](#required-secrets))
4. Build action
## Required env variables
| Secret | Description |
| -------------------------- | --------------------- |
| `OP_SERVICE_ACCOUNT_TOKEN` | Service Account token |
| `VAULT` | Vault name |
| `VAULT_ID` | Vault UUID |
## Building Before Testing
If you've modified TypeScript code, rebuild before running E2E tests:
```bash
npm run build
```
## Testing
### Run E2E tests using Service Account
```bash
act push -W .github/workflows/e2e-tests.yml \
-s OP_SERVICE_ACCOUNT_TOKEN="$OP_SERVICE_ACCOUNT_TOKEN" \
-s VAULT="$VAULT" \
-j test-service-account \
--matrix os:ubuntu-latest
```
## Run unit tests
```bash
npm test
```

// #region Op ref parsing
interface ParsedOpRef {
vault: string;
item: string;
section: string | undefined;
field: string;
queryParams: string | undefined;
}
export const parseOpRef = (ref: string): ParsedOpRef => {
// Safety check: refs are validated by validateSecretRefs before this runs
// this guards against parseOpRef being called directly with invalid input
if (!ref.startsWith("op://")) {
throw new Error(`Invalid op reference: ${ref}`);
}
const segments = ref
.slice("op://".length)
.split("/")
.map((s) => decodeURIComponent(s));
if (segments.length < 3 || segments.length > 4) {
throw new Error(
`Invalid op reference: use op://<vault>/<item>/<field> or op://<vault>/<item>/<section>/<field>. Got: ${ref}`,
);
}
const vault = segments[0] ?? "";
if (!vault) {
throw new Error(`Invalid op reference: vault is required`);
}
const item = segments[1] ?? "";
if (!item) {
throw new Error(`Invalid op reference: item is required`);
}
// Last segment is the field; it may include a query string (e.g. "private key?ssh-format=openssh")
const lastSegment = segments[segments.length - 1] ?? "";
const [fieldPart, queryPart] = lastSegment.split("?");
const field = fieldPart ?? "";
if (!field) {
throw new Error(`Invalid op reference: field is required`);
}
const queryParams = queryPart ?? undefined;
// Second to last segment is the section if it exists
let section: string | undefined;
if (segments.length === 4) {
section = segments[2];
if (!section) {
throw new Error(
`Invalid op reference: section is required when using 4 path segments`,
);
}
}
return {
vault,
item,
field,
section,
queryParams,
};
};
